Optical and Kinetic Processes in Excimer Lasers
Abstract
This report summarizes a program of research on optical and kinetic processes of importance for excimer laser systems. The research consists of four major topics: (1) investigations of the spectroscopy and chemical kinetics of XeF and XeCl lasers using theoretical techniques, synchrotron radiation excitation, and laser-induced fluorescence, (2) measurement of the angle, wavelength, temperature, and density dependencies of vibrational and rotational Raman gain in H2, D2, and N2, (3) studies of stimulated Rayleigh-Brillouin scattering in gases, and (4) investigation of other topics in lasers and nonlinear optics....
